The application program arranges for request parcels to be generated but does not view them directly if the Request Mode is Parcel Mode and a DBCAREAX is not being used. If a DBCAREAX is being used, then the application builds parcels directly in the DBCAREAX.
If Request Mode is Buffer Mode, then parcels are built directly in the Request buffer.
The following table lists the request parcels in numerical order.
Parcel Flavor | Parcel Name | Parcel Use | Parcel Length | Fields in Parcel Body |
---|---|---|---|---|
1 | Req | Initiates a request | 5-12504 | ReqText |
2 | RunStartup | Executes the user’s startup request | 4 | None |
3 | Data | Contains data for a Teradata SQL request | 5-32004/65104 | Data |
4 | Resp | Request portion of Teradata SQL response | 6 | MaxMsgSize |
5 | KeepResp | Requests a portion of Teradata SQL response without discarding response | 6 | MaxMsgSize |
6 | Abort | Attempts to abort a request | 4 | None |
7 | Cancel | Discards Teradata SQL response and closes Teradata SQL request; discards those segments of a segmented data request that have already been sent. | 4 | None |
13 | FMReq | Initiates a request | 5-12504 | ReqText |
14 | FMRunStartup | Executes the user’s startup request | 4 | None |
31 | Rewind | Positions spool file pointer to beginning of the spool file | 4 | None |
36 | Logon | Establishes a session | 132 | LogonString |
37 | Logoff | Terminates a session | 4 | None |
38 | Run | Connects to specified server on the COP for workstation-attached clients or to the specified IFP partition for mainframe-attached systems | 20 | PartitionName |
42 | Config | |||
68 | IndicData | Contains data for a Teradata SQL request | 6-32004/65104 | NullIndic Data |
69 | IndicReq | Initiates a request | 5-12504 | ReqText |
71 | DataInfo | Sends description of whichever data parcel follows it | 6-32004/65104 | FieldCount Groups:
|
72 | IVRunStartup | Executes the user’s startup request | 4 | None |
85 | Options | Specified which PREPARE options are used when a request is sent to the database | 14 |
|
88 | Connect | Connects to specified server on the COP for workstation-attached systems | 28 | PartitionName LogonSequenceNumber Functions |
100 | Assign | Request a session COP | 36 | UserName |
106 | SesInfo | |||
114 | SessionOptions | Session options | 14 |
|
120 | CursorHost | Provides cursor information. | 18 | Processor Row Request |
123 | Xindicreq | 1 to 8196 | Reqtxt | |
125 | PrepInfoX | 1 to Maximum parcel size |
|
|
128 | Multi-TSR | Segments special-purpose requests into multiple parcels | 7 | Sequence number IsLast |
129 | SP Options | Provides options for creation of a Stored Procedure. | 6 | Print Option SPL Option |
140 | Multipart Record | 2 to 32000 | Data | |
141 | End Multipart Record | 2 | None | |
142 | Multipart IndicData | 2 to 32000 | Data | |
143 | EndMultipart Indicdata | 2 | None | |
146 | DataInfoX | 6 to 32004 | FieldCount Datatype, Length pairs |
|
148 | MultiPart Request | 1 to Maximum parcel size | Request Text |